Transaction 012e57576213e90b83bf8f7d05a93cf96a084ecd61f0a759251f0836410f64b8

1 Input
2 Outputs
  • 012e57576213e90b83bf8f7d05a93cf96a084ecd61f0a759251f0836410f64b8:0
  • value  2022200
    address  1FgU8g32CNwV4MCGGtHWSJ4Miir2QQqzT5
  • 012e57576213e90b83bf8f7d05a93cf96a084ecd61f0a759251f0836410f64b8:1
  • value  3088606
    address  13cGuHHGspriVLQktZWpzCg6LSjB8m6U5B